Roberta Shor was a chemist at the Metallurgical Laboratory in Chicago during the Manhattan Project.
George Banic worked on high voltage power supplies for the General Electric Company in Schenectady, New York, and came to Oak Ridge in March 1944, to help with the Y-12 Plant.
Kenneth Zaring was a staff worker at Los Alamos during the Manhattan Project.
Julius “Osty” Ostspowicz was a glassblower in the Chemistry Division at the University of Chicago’s Metallurgical Laboratory during the Manhattan Project.
